Com Desactivar La Memòria Intermèdia

Taula de continguts:

Com Desactivar La Memòria Intermèdia
Com Desactivar La Memòria Intermèdia

Vídeo: Com Desactivar La Memòria Intermèdia

Vídeo: Com Desactivar La Memòria Intermèdia
Vídeo: Ремонт НР Color LaserJet CP1515n. Reparação HP Color LaserJet CP1515n 2024, De novembre
Anonim

La memòria intermèdia de vegades s’utilitza per representar una pàgina web per minimitzar el nombre d’intents de representar HTML o dades del codi a les pàgines ASP del navegador client, augmentant així el rendiment general. TCP / IP està dissenyat de manera que sigui més eficient enviar dades al client en grans trossos.

Com desactivar la memòria intermèdia
Com desactivar la memòria intermèdia

Necessari

Editor HTML

Instruccions

Pas 1

La pàgina es fa més lenta a causa de la memòria intermèdia, a partir del que s'envia als usuaris només després de finalitzar-la. Per tant, per a les pàgines generades per scripts durant molt de temps, podeu desactivar la memòria intermèdia totalment o parcialment.

Pas 2

Utilitzeu l'ordre Response. Buffer = False per desactivar completament la memòria intermèdia. Aquest mètode enviarà dades a l'usuari immediatament.

Pas 3

Utilitzeu el mètode Response. Flush. Per desactivar parcialment la memòria intermèdia, necessitareu un algorisme d’accions més complex, però sembla que és més preferible. Utilitza el mètode Response. Flush, que envia tot l’HTML acumulat al buffer al client.

Pas 4

Per exemple, després de generar les primeres cent files d'una taula que té una mida total de 1.000 files, els scripts ASP criden Response. Flush per enviar el primer fragment de la pàgina al navegador del client. Aquest enfocament permet a l'usuari veure les primeres cent files fins i tot abans que tota la taula estigui llesta. A més, és possible enviar-lo al client en les mateixes parts durant la generació d’una nova línia.

Pas 5

Aquest treball amb la memòria intermèdia és el més òptim, aconsegueix un augment tangible del nivell de rendiment i la capacitat de carregar pàgines calculades durant un llarg període de temps per etapes, sense obligar els visitants del recurs a esperar molt de temps al davant. d'una finestra neta del navegador.

Pas 6

Divideix la pàgina en blocs de construcció. És important recordar que alguns navegadors no admeten la visualització de parts d’una taula; esperaran que es tanqui. En aquest cas, heu de simular aquest tancament; per exemple, es pot dividir una taula gran en cent files, tal com es descriu anteriorment. En aquest cas, després de generar la següent subtaula, es pot enviar als usuaris mitjançant el mètode Response. Flush.

Pas 7

Apliqueu el mètode Flush. En alguns casos, és possible que la tecnologia de desactivació parcial de la memòria intermèdia consumeixi gran quantitat de memòria del servidor a la zona de generació de pàgines molt grans. Sense utilitzar el mètode Flush, no serà possible assegurar l’ús correcte d’aquesta tecnologia i evitar un ús excessiu innecessari del recurs del sistema. L’inconvenient d’aquest mètode és que, per tal que l’usuari mostri correctament la taula a la pantalla, cal assegurar-se que es creen columnes del mateix ample a cadascuna de les subtaules.

Recomanat: